Wagering Requirements Explained: What 35x or 50x Really Means
Wagering requirements determine how many times you must bet your bonus winnings before withdrawing. A 40x requirement on £20 of winnings means you must place £800 in bets before cashing out. That number alone explains why most free spin bonuses never result in payouts.
The calculation varies by operator. Some apply wagering to the bonus amount only, while others include the deposit. Since no deposit bonuses involve no deposit, wagering applies exclusively to winnings. This distinction makes no deposit offers simpler to evaluate than their deposit-based counterparts.
How do you calculate whether a 20 free spins offer is worth claiming?
Start with the average win from 20 spins. At £0.20 per spin, the total staked is £4. Slots typically return between 92% and 96%, giving an expected win of £3.68 to £3.84. Multiply that by the wagering requirement to determine your expected playthrough burden.
With a 40x requirement, you must wager approximately £147 to £154 before withdrawal. At a 96% return rate, your expected loss during wagering is £5.88 to £6.16. Since your expected win is only £3.84, the mathematical expectation is negative — the house edge consumes your winnings before you can withdraw.
Which wagering structures benefit players most?
No wagering offers, like those from MrQ and PlayOJO, eliminate the playthrough burden entirely. Your winnings from 20 free spins become withdrawable cash immediately, subject only to verification checks. This structure provides the highest expected value of any bonus type available in the UK market.
Low wagering offers between 1x and 10x provide reasonable value. A 5x requirement on £4 of expected winnings means wagering £20 before withdrawal. At 96% RTP, your expected loss during wagering is £0.80, leaving approximately £3.04 of your original winnings intact.

Addiction Prevention: Tools Licensed Casinos Must Provide
Problem gambling affects approximately 0.5% of UK adults, according to Gambling Commission data from 2024. That figure translates to roughly 250,000 people. Licensed operators have a legal obligation to provide tools that help players identify problematic behaviour before it escalates into addiction.
The science behind problem gambling identification has advanced considerably since 2020. Behavioural analytics now track deposit frequency, session length, and loss patterns to flag at-risk players. UKGC-licensed casinos must implement these systems and intervene when algorithms detect concerning patterns.
What early warning signs should players monitor?
Chasing losses ranks as the most reliable predictor of developing gambling problems. When you increase bet sizes after a losing session, you override rational decision-making with emotional impulse. Licensed casinos monitor this behaviour and should trigger responsible gambling interventions when patterns emerge.
Time distortion represents another warning sign. Players who lose track of session duration often gamble longer than intended. The UKGC requires operators to display session timers prominently, and many casinos now send mandatory break reminders every 60 minutes of continuous play.
How do deposit limits prevent problem gambling?
Deposit limits cap how much you can add to your account within a set period. UKGC rules require all licensed operators to offer these tools, with daily, weekly, and monthly options. Setting a £50 weekly limit means the casino cannot accept deposits beyond that threshold until the period resets.
Reality checks serve a complementary function. These pop-up notifications appear at intervals you choose — typically every 15, 30, or 60 minutes — showing your time played and net losses. The UKGC mandates that all licensed casinos offer reality checks, and players must acknowledge each notification before continuing play.
Where can UK players access self-exclusion tools?
GAMSTOP is the national self-exclusion scheme covering all UKGC-licensed online casinos. Registering with GAMSTOP blocks you from gambling at every participating operator for a minimum period of 6 months. Since 2023, the service has expanded to include land-based venues through a separate registration.
Beyond GAMSTOP, the National Gambling Helpline offers confidential support at 0808 8020 133. The service operates 24 hours daily, 365 days per year, staffed by trained advisors. Calls are free from UK landlines and mobiles, and no personal details are required to access support.

Comparing 20 Free Spins Offers: Which Games Give Best Value?
Game selection determines the real value of any free spins bonus. A slot with 96.5% RTP returns more of your wagered money than one with 92%. Pragmatic Play’s Big Bass series, NetEnt’s Starburst, and Microgaming’s Book of Atem all feature RTPs above 96%, making them popular choices for bonus offers.
Volatility matters equally. High volatility slots like Hacksaw Gaming’s titles pay less frequently but offer larger jackpots. Low volatility games provide smaller, more regular wins. For 20 free spins, low to medium volatility slots typically produce better outcomes because your limited spins benefit from more frequent payouts.

How do progressive jackpot slots affect free spins value?
Progressive jackpot slots like Mega Moolah allocate a portion of each bet to the jackpot pool, reducing their base RTP. Microgaming’s Mega Moolah has an RTP of 88.12%, significantly below the 96% market average. Free spins on this game carry lower expected value than standard slots.
The trade-off involves jackpot potential. Mega Moolah’s progressive jackpot has paid out over £20 million in a single spin, making the low RTP acceptable to some players. For 20 free spins, the probability of hitting the jackpot remains astronomically low — approximately 1 in 50 million per spin.

Responsible Gambling: Setting Limits Before You Start
Setting boundaries before claiming any bonus protects you from problematic behaviour. The UKGC mandates that all licensed operators provide deposit limits, loss limits, and session reminders. Configuring these tools takes less than 2 minutes and can prevent hours of uncontrolled gambling.
Deposit limits work alongside free spins bonuses. Even though no deposit offers require no initial funding, subsequent deposits remain subject to your configured limits. Setting a weekly deposit limit of £100 ensures you cannot exceed that amount regardless of promotional temptations.
How do cooling-off periods work at UK casinos?
Cooling-off periods allow temporary breaks from gambling without full self-exclusion. You can request a 24-hour, 48-hour, or 7-day break from any licensed operator. During this period, the casino blocks your account and prevents deposits. The operator must honour your request immediately upon receipt.
Extended self-exclusion through GAMSTOP lasts 6 months, 1 year, or 5 years. Once registered, all UKGC-licensed casinos must block your access within 24 hours. GAMSTOP registration is irreversible until the chosen period expires, though you can extend it at any time.
Which support services help players with gambling problems?
The National Gambling Helpline operates at 0808 8020 133, providing free confidential support around the clock. Trained advisors offer practical advice on controlling gambling behaviour, accessing self-exclusion tools, and managing financial consequences. No referral is necessary — you can call directly.
GamCare provides additional resources through their website, including live chat support and online forums. Their counselling services help players understand the psychological mechanisms behind problem gambling. The NHS also offers specialist clinics in England for severe gambling disorders, with referrals available through GPs.
